Project N.V.

Hello,

I know that this board is 98% used to post beautiful pictures of keyboards, etc but I thought I share my latest built up of my PC, where I use my fantastic boards with - as also some of the members here told me to show this built.

This built´s project name is called N.V.
The pc is mainly used for photo and video edeting and I use it for my job to use it with SQL server… so lots of power is needed.
It will run almost 24/ a day, and one oft he main goals was to run it very silent and still can overclock it nicly. For this reason I have choosen two seperate watercooling circles, with big radiators and lots of  fans, to run the fans at very low rmp and have a very silent setup-
Case I decided to go with CaseLabs – modell TH10. This ist he most perfect case ever built and fantasic us built quality, with lots of space and modular setup.

I got lots of inspiration on severall forums and great contacts… through these contacts it happed that the built will be a joined work from poPe and E22  from Denmark and UK, that help to make this built a very unique setup with nice customizing.

I hope to get this done by end of april, …. So enjoy and hope you like it and looking forward to your feedback.
Also I need to thank EKWB, Corsair and Bitspower who are the sponsors of this built.

Main Guts

CPU: Intel Core i7-3930K
Motherboard: Asrock Extreme 11
GPU: 3x EVGA GTX 680’s 4GB
Memory: Corsair Dominator GT 1866 64GB
PSU: Corsair AX1200i.


Storage
OS Drive: 2x 256 gb SSD Samsung 840 in Raid 0
Raid 0 Array: 1x WD Red 2TB


Cooling

radiator: 3x XSPX RC 480
pumps: 4x Aqua Computer D5 pumps mit USB and aquabus interface
Pump Tops: Aqua Computer für D5-adapter
reseroir´s: Custom
fans: 24 x Corsair
CPU Waterblock: EKWB EK-Supremacy Elite - Intel 2011
GPU Waterblocks: 3 x EKWB EK-FC680
Motherboard Waterblocks: AE11
RAM: 2 x EKWB EK-RAM Dominator X4 - Nickel CSQ

Tubing:Crystal Link
Fittings: Bitspower Black!


Monitoring

AquaComputer Aquaero 5 XT
3 x AquaComputer Power Adjust USB Ultra
3 x AquaComputer flow sensors
3 x AquaComputer temp sensors
2 x AquaComputer pressure sensors


Misc

Monitore: 2 x 27"
sound: Asus Xonar 2.0 STX
Sleeving: MDPC-X;
Blu-Ray/DVD Reader/Writer: LG Blue Ray Disc Writer
